Transaction d23523334781ea741fea8738b9246fc451868de71cf0e704fa2be2bdbd843d49
1 Input
2 Outputs
- d23523334781ea741fea8738b9246fc451868de71cf0e704fa2be2bdbd843d49:0
- d23523334781ea741fea8738b9246fc451868de71cf0e704fa2be2bdbd843d49:1
value 16127764
address 15VD2cAG5cKA9Np4wvCsAPHnpb4GCFRm2m
value 33238651
address 18UBpQ5sDf3b2xEvGzCgPPGJNtvZcabYSs